The application will not exit properly when receiving SIGINT while active http requests are being made. This example shows prometheus polling the server and when a SIGINT is received, the foreground returns to the terminal prompt, but the process remains alive and continues to output logging info (via morgan) to the terminal
Install the dependencies via yarn
and ensure you are on at least the node version specified in the .nvmrc
Docker is required to start prometheus. Use docker-compose against the file for your operating system (windows not included)
docker-compose -f docker-compose.darwin.yml up -d
will start prometheus.
Start the nest process via
yarn start
and send a SIGINT whenever to see the behavior.
